TL;DR Ignore this whole thread - nothing’s bugged; I just missed a room exit and spent a lot of time chasing my tail trying to figure out what was wrong. ========== I got to the “choose your faction” section of the critical path, right before you head to the special island. I chose to go with the Huana, and Queen Onekaza gave me the quest “The Shadow Under Neketaka” - go talk to Watershaper Guildmaster Mairu to see why she’s not responding to messages. For various reasons, I had never yet entered the Watershaper’s Guild (wasn’t too interested in using Tekehu this time around). When I got there, the naga attack had happened, and Ekenu and Tekehu were there, but Mairu wasn’t. They told me Mairu was under the guildhall, fighting off the last of the nagas, and suggested I go down below to help her out. When I went down, I wasn’t able to do anything with the magically locked entrance to the under-guildhall area. I could push it, punch it, and inspect it, but nothing else. I did a bunch of things to figure out what was going wrong, including loading a save from before the faction choice, talking to Mairu / picking up Tekehu, and doing everything over, but nothing worked. I started googling for help and found that Mairu is supposed to be on the main level of the Guildhall when you get there, wounded, and she teaches you an incantation and gives you a quest item Rod to unlock the door below. I even went looking in the game’s data files for a quest ID to see if I could console in some help, but using the DebugAdvanceQuest command didn’t help - there was no way I could see to set the decisions made during the quest. When I did that to close the quest and went back to Onekaza, she treated me as though we weren’t in the endgame. I’m fairly certain this is a bug, but I don’t know how far back in saved games I have to go to get to a branch that will let me complete the game on the Huana side. Has anyone encountered this? Since no one else (per Google searches) appears to have posted on this before, I doubt it’ll be fixed soon, so I’m probably going to hold my RPer nose and pick a different faction to finish the game for this playthrough. On my next playthrough I’m planning to make the watcher a Huana; I’ll definitely go visit the watershapers earlier and see if that helps me side with Onekaza. Thanks for any help you can provide.

I tried a battlemage (wizard/fighter) at first but wasn’t really feeling it, so I restarted with a spellblade (wizard/rogue) and I’m loving it so far - level 16 at the moment. However, I’m keeping all my companions single-classed so I can get unambiguous support - Edér as tank, Xoti as healer, etc. In the beta, I tried out a fully multi-classed party several times, and really liked it, but the content was limited so I knew what to expect. For the full game, I feel as though it’s safer to have straight-up support roles at least on my [almost] first run. That said, as I near the top power levels, I find myself looking wistfully at those two levels of spells I’ll never get to use with my spellblade. She’s incredibly effective, especially wielding Marux Amanth at its full potential, but I’d like to see what she could do fully powered. For that I’ll have to use Aloth, I guess. In PoE 1, I really enjoyed custom (hired) companions after the first couple of play-throughs. I’ll probably try a fully multi-classed party eventually. Or possibly *I’ll* go single class -probably wizard, maybe paladin - and have multi-classed companions. In any case, I love the flexibility.

Description: My default Mercenary Fighter has a single wound (Bruised Ribs). Repeated rests with food aren't healing him. Steps to Reproduce the Issue: The Mercenary Fighter was knocked out in a battle and rose with Bruised Ribs. I went to the Rest screen and added Hagfish to his food slot, then rested. After the animation, he still had Bruised Ribs. I tried again with Silverfish. Same result. Important Files: Savegames Savegame is included, with .txt appended so it's uploadable. Output Log Output log is too big to upload. System Specs Specs included as "DxDiag.txt". Screenshots Screenshot is apparently too big to upload in conjunction with the other files. Combat does not stop after opponents are dead
Epimetreus posted a question in Backer Beta Bugs and Support
Description: Combat didn't stop after a fight with the Engwithan titan and a scarab. Steps to Reproduce the Issue: I initiated combat with the Engwithan titan (and a scarab joined the combat). Three of my party were knocked out; two remained standing. The titan was killed. The scarab was killed. Combat did not end; my chanter kept chanting, and I couldn't see a way to stop combat. Eventually I reloaded the quicksave from just before the combat. This time, things proceeded normally and combat ended upon the death of the opponents.
